Clix Leaves NRG: Future Plans & Emotional Farewell

Clix's NRG Departure Announcement

Fortnite pro Clix (Cody Conrod) has officially left NRG after a transformative 2.5-year partnership. In an emotional video update, he revealed NRG's complete exit from the Fortnite scene—a decision that ended their collaboration. Clix emphasized NRG's pivotal role in his career growth: "Without them, I wouldn’t be anywhere I am now." This marks a significant career shift for one of Fortnite’s top streamers, who described the separation as "sad" but views it as the start of a "bright future."

Why NRG and Clix Parted Ways

NRG’s strategic withdrawal from Fortnite directly triggered Clix’s departure. The organization, which housed iconic creators like Unknown and Edgey, dissolved its Fortnite operations entirely. Clix clarified this wasn’t a personal rift but a structural change: "Energy is leaving the whole Fortnite scene as a whole." He praised NRG as "one of the best organizations I’ve been on," highlighting their support during milestone moments like hitting 125,000 concurrent viewers. Industry analysts note this reflects broader esports contractions, with Orgs streamlining rosters amid shifting revenue models.

Clix’s Career Reflections and Future Moves

Clix’s NRG tenure featured career-defining highlights: moving into the NRG content house, viral collaborations, and global recognition. He nostalgically recalled living with teammates: "Being able to just go in Ron’s room and joke around... that’s definitely my favorite." Regarding future Orgs, he’s cautiously selective: "If I do join another, it would have to be worth it." His immediate focus is doubling down on content: daily Twitch streams and increased YouTube uploads to "touch closer" with his community.

What’s Next for Clix?

Clix confirmed three priorities:

  1. Daily Twitch Consistency: Maintaining his core streaming schedule
  2. YouTube Expansion: Creating more personal vlogs and updates
  3. Strategic Org Evaluation: Only partnering if terms offer exceptional value
    He’ll continue leveraging his 7M+ follower base while exploring new content formats. Industry insiders suggest individual branding could maximize revenue amid esports’ volatility.
